Error Calculation Formulas

Percent Error:

PE = |Experimental - True| / |True| × 100%

Absolute Error:

AE = |Experimental Value - True Value|

Relative Error:

RE = |Experimental - True| / |True|

Accuracy:

Accuracy = 100% - Percent Error

These formulas provide a complete picture of measurement quality, helping scientists and engineers evaluate the reliability of their experimental data and identify areas for improvement.

Error Classification and Interpretation

Understanding the magnitude and significance of percent error is crucial for scientific analysis. Our calculator automatically classifies errors and provides interpretations to help you understand whether your measurements meet acceptable standards for your specific application.

  • Excellent accuracy (<1% error) indicates high-precision measurements
  • Good accuracy (1-5% error) is acceptable for most scientific applications
  • Moderate accuracy (5-10% error) may be acceptable for engineering estimates
  • Poor accuracy (>10% error) suggests measurement methodology issues

Example Calculation

Laboratory Measurement Example
Analyzing the accuracy of a density measurement experiment

Experimental Setup:

  • True Density of Water: 1.000 g/cm³ (at 4°C)
  • Measured Density: 0.985 g/cm³
  • Measurement Method: Volume displacement

Error Analysis:

  1. Absolute Error: |0.985 - 1.000| = 0.015 g/cm³
  2. Percent Error: (0.015 / 1.000) × 100% = 1.5%
  3. Relative Error: 0.015 / 1.000 = 0.015
  4. Accuracy: 100% - 1.5% = 98.5%

Result: 1.5% error indicates good measurement accuracy for this experiment

This level of error is typical for student laboratory measurements and falls within acceptable limits for density determination experiments. The slight underestimation could be due to temperature variations, measurement technique, or instrument precision limitations.
